1 AEGI Adult Educational Guidance Initiative What is the Adult Educational Guidance Initiative (AEGI)? The AEGI is a Department of Education and Skills funded initiative which provides a quality educational guidance service for adults. There are currently 39 AEGI Services based nationwide within the Education Training Boards (ETBs) and Waterford Institute of Technology (WIT) What does the AEGI offer? The AEGI helps people to make informed educational career and life choices. Adults can start from where they left off in education and the Guidance Service will support the adult from where he or she is right now. Who is it for? Every adult can access the Guidance Service for the purposes of up to date impartial adult educational information. Those adults who left school without formal qualifications are also eligible for one-toone guidance and group guidance. The puts a special emphasis on those adults who may wish to increase their levels of literacy; those at risk of long term unemployment; those in the workplace who may wish to build on their basic skills and adults who are ineligible to be on the Live Register and are currently not working. Will it cost anything? The service is free to adults in the categories referred to above. Definition of Guidance Guidance facilitates people throughout their lives to manage their own educational, training, occupational, personal, social and life choices so that the reach their full potential and contribute to the development of a better society National Guidance Forum 2007
